The Concord Spiders will venture away from home to take on the Carson Cougars at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Concord will be strutting in after a win while Carson will be coming in after a loss.
Carson better have a healthy lead at halftime, because if Concord's game on Tuesday is any indication, that's when Concord really gets things going. The Spiders were the clear victors by a 5-1 margin over East Rowan. Considering Concord have won four contests by more than two goals this season, Tuesday's blowout was nothing new.
They hit East Rowan with a three-pronged attack, as the team got scores from Yeimi Gomez (3), Piper Martin, and Vivienne Grant.
Meanwhile, Carson was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their fourth straight defeat. They came up short against South Rowan, falling 9-0. That's two games in a row now that Carson have lost by exactly nine goals.
Carson's loss dropped their record down to 2-6. As for Concord, their victory was their first in the conference, bumping their conference record up to 1-4 and their overall record up to 4-5.
